We have an exciting opportunity for a Workshop Technician to join a friendly, supportive, and positive Construction team. The role is varied with lots of opportunity to develop new skills and knowledge.

You will:

  • Prepare and maintain materials and equipment used by students in the workshops
  • Support the dismantling of work prepared by students to maintain operational status of the workshops
  • Carry out maintenance of workshops
  • Ensure adequate stock levels of materials are maintained
  • Implement appropriate Health and Safety systems
  • Support the instruction of learners in practical activity

As a Workshop Technician, you should be confident, well organised, and have specialist vocational skills in the Construction Industry.

You should:

  • Hold a Level 2 or equivalent qualification in a construction trade.
  • GCSE English and Maths A -C or equivalent
  • First Aid qualification, or willingness to achieve within six months
  • A wide range of experience gained within the Construction Industry
